Nicki Minaj calls out Miley Cyrus at VMA

Rapper Nicki Minaj blasted host Miley Cyrus while accepting her Best Hip-Hop Video trophy at the 2015 MTV Video Music Awards for the comments that 'Wrecking Ball' hitmaker had made about her.
Cyrus, 22, had earlier said in an interview that the 32-year-old "Anaconda" hitmakers's comments about the show's nomination process were not polite, reported Entertainment Weekly.
Minaj took to the stage to accept her award and said, "You know who I want to thank tonight? My pastor. I love you so much. And now, back to this b**** that had a lot to say about me in the press. Miley what's good?"
Cyrus, who won Video of the Year in 2014 for "Wrecking Ball", was apparently caught off-guard by Minaj's comments.
"We're all in this industry. We all do interviews. We all know how they manipulate. Nicki, congratulations," she said.
The "When I Look At You" singer said she lost an award in 2009 but was fine with it and congratulated Minaj.
Moments after her remarks, the rapper tweeted "Lmfaooooooooooooo" with a trio of heart-eye emojis.
According to a source the confrontation was real and not staged.
